概括
大西洋轴突突变 (AAS) 影响7.2%的唐氏综合征 (DS) 的住院患者. 这项研究发现,与非DS患者相比,年轻的DS患者患有AAS的并发症较少,但手术需求相似.

背景情况:
- 大西洋轴突突变 (AAS) 涉及C1-C2脊椎 misalignment,造成神经风险.
- 唐氏综合征 (DS) 与AAS的患病率较高有关.
- 在DS中理解AAS对于患者护理至关重要.
研究的目的:
- 确定在被诊断患有大西洋轴突突变 (AAS) 的住院患者中唐氏综合征 (DS) 的患病率.
- 在AAS患者和没有DS患者之间比较人口统计学特征,并发病症和医院结局.
主要方法:
- 使用国家住院样本 (NIS) 数据库从2016年到2020年.
- 雇员国际疾病分类第十版的代码用于DS和AAS的识别.
- 使用多变量回归分析了人口统计,并发病,住院过程和结果.
主要成果:
- 在住院的AAS患者中,7.2%被诊断为DS.
- DS患者显著年轻,不太可能是女性或患有常见的并发症.
- 在DS和非DS AAS患者之间没有观察到手术融合率的显著差异.
结论:
- 在住院的AAS患者中,很大一部分患有唐氏综合征.
- 人口统计和并发症概况在患有和没有DS的AAS患者之间有所不同.
- 这些发现可以为DS患者群体中AAS量身定制的治疗方案提供信息.

During meiosis, chromosomes occasionally separate improperly. This occurs due to failure of homologous chromosome separation during meiosis I or failed sister chromatid separation during meiosis II. In some species, notably plants, nondisjunction can result in an organism with an entire additional set of chromosomes, which is called polyploidy. In humans, nondisjunction can occur during male or female gametogenesis and the resulting gametes possess one too many or one too few chromosomes.
